The Ceramic Pipe market is a subset of the larger Ceramics industry. Ceramic pipes are used in a variety of applications, including plumbing, industrial, and medical. They are made from a variety of materials, including clay, porcelain, and glass. Ceramic pipes are known for their durability, heat resistance, and chemical resistance. They are also lightweight and easy to install.
Ceramic pipes are used in a variety of industries, including automotive, aerospace, and construction. They are also used in medical applications, such as for dental implants and prosthetics.
The Ceramic Pipe market is highly competitive, with many companies offering a wide range of products. Some of the leading companies in the market include Saint-Gobain, CeramTec, Morgan Advanced Materials, and Kyocera. These companies offer a variety of products, including pipes, fittings, and valves.
